A Day I Will Never Forget
By Deserae Kehler
Edmonton is home to the most memorable day of my life!
My husband and I had dated for 5 years before getting engaged 2 days before he left for basic training. It would be another 2 years plus before we settled in our new rental in Lancaster Park, a.k.a. Edmonton Garrison.
Our life in Edmonton has always been bittersweet. We finally got married on November 17, 2007. It was far from the happiest day of my life. My husband was training out of town during ALL of the planning. Did I fail to mention that I was 5 months pregnant? With no family in Alberta, I turned to my co-army wives for support.
Somehow we made it to the big day. Hooray—right? Wrong. At 8 AM I get a call from my bridesmaid claiming I ignored her yesterday at rehearsal and she was not going to stand by me today. Now short-handed, I leap into action to try and stay on schedule. Not even close. I arrived at the ceremony in sweat pants—at the exact time I was supposed to be walking down the aisle. |
Little did I know that this would not be the climax. Remember that my husband was not involved at all in the planning of this event— he actually hasn’t even seen where we were to be wed. So naturally being new to Edmonton, he gets lost. Considering all the groomsmen are from out of province as well, it takes them 3 hours to find us!
How did he eventually find it? Someone at the wedding told him he could see a low flying Boeing 757. Since Alan could see the same plane, he used it to navigate his way!!
The ceremony was beautiful. But we weren’t able to take photos as it was too late and the dance floor at the reception was pretty dead because dinner was also late!
Oops!
So maybe it wasn’t the best day of my life, but who else in Edmonton has a wedding story like that??? It’s certainly a day I will NEVER forget!
